effigy
countable noun: An effigy is a quickly and roughly made figure, often ugly or amusing, that represents someone you hate or feel contempt for. countable noun: An effigy is a statue or carving of a famous person. effigy in American English a portrait, statue, or the like, esp. of a person; likeness; often, a crude representation of a despised person noun: a representation or image, esp. sculptured, as on a monument effigy in British English noun: a portrait of a person, esp as a monument or architectural decoration |
